Summary
Organizations are beginning to roll out the Information Workplace (IW) — a cohesive environment that reduces the need to "manually" integrate disparate repositories and applications with the ALT + TAB keys. The IW may have its roots in a collaboration system, or in a specific business process such as case management. But for many organizations, a well-functioning corporate intranet offers a strong foundation on which to build the IW. Content and collaboration professionals can evaluate the suitability of their intranet to support an Information Workplace initiative.
